Why Does Stainless Steel Resist Rust?

The secret behind stainless steel’s rust resistance is its unique composition.

Stainless steel contains chromium, which reacts with oxygen to create a thin protective layer called a passive layer.

This invisible layer helps protect the metal surface from:

  • Oxidation
  • Corrosion
  • Moisture damage
  • Environmental exposure

Unlike metals that continue to deteriorate after being exposed to air or water, stainless steel can naturally repair this protective layer when it is damaged.

Because of this property, high-quality stainless steel jewelry can maintain its appearance for a long time with proper care.

Why Does Some Stainless Steel Jewelry Rust?

Although stainless steel is highly resistant to rust, not all stainless steel jewelry has the same quality.

Lower-quality materials or poor manufacturing processes may reduce corrosion resistance.

Several factors can affect jewelry durability:

1. Material Quality

Premium stainless steel, such as 316L stainless steel, provides excellent corrosion resistance and is commonly used for high-quality jewelry.

2. Chemical Exposure

Long-term contact with harsh chemicals may affect the surface of jewelry.

Examples include:

  • Chlorine
  • Strong cleaning products
  • Certain cosmetic chemicals

3. Lack of Maintenance

Although stainless steel requires minimal care, regular cleaning helps remove dirt, oils, and residue that may affect the surface over time.

Does Stainless Steel Jewelry Turn Black?

Another common concern is: "Will stainless steel jewelry turn black?"

Generally, high-quality stainless steel jewelry does not easily turn black.

Unlike some metals that naturally oxidize, stainless steel is designed to maintain its color and shine.

However, surface buildup from:

  • Sweat
  • Body oils
  • Cosmetics
  • Dust

may make jewelry appear darker or less shiny.

A simple cleaning routine can usually restore its original appearance.

How to Prevent Stainless Steel Jewelry from Rusting

Although stainless steel jewelry is durable, proper care can help extend its lifespan.

Follow these simple tips:

Clean Regularly

Use warm water, mild soap, and a soft cloth to remove dirt and oils.

Avoid Strong Chemicals

Remove jewelry before using strong cleaning products or chemicals.

Dry After Water Exposure

Although stainless steel is water-resistant, drying your jewelry after prolonged exposure helps maintain its shine.

Store Properly

Keep jewelry in a dry place and avoid storing pieces where they may scratch against each other.
